NINES ENGAGE IN OUTDOOR WORKOUT

Coach Mitchell Will Choose Players for Sonthern Trip in Day or So--1931 Team B Defeats Team A

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Both the University and Freshman baseball teams were able to take to outdoor diamonds yesterday afternoon for the first practice games of the training season. Owing to the rather soft condition of the turf, the Harvard nine, confined to the cage since last Tuesday when it went out for a brief session of batting practice, did not use the regular diamond, but limited itself to one of the class fields.

No cut in the squad has been made as yet, but within the next day or two Coach Mitchell will choose the players who will journey south during the spring recess. The two University teams lined up as follows:

Team A--J. S. Cunningham '29, Howard Whitmore '29, p.; W. W. Lord '28, c.; John Prior '29, 1b.; J. P. Chase '28, 2b.; G. E. Donaghy '29, 3b.; Burns, S.S.; R. R. Durkee '29, l.f.; G. K. Brown '28, c.f.; W. S. Hardie '30, r.f.

Team B--E. A. Colpak '29, R. R. Ketchum '29, p.; D. P. Donaldson '28, E. J. Steptoe '29, c.; D. M. Davis '30, 1b.; J. J. Carver '30, 2b.; E. T. Putnam '29, 3b.; F. E. Nugent '30, s.s.; John Tudor '29, l.f.; K. W. Crotty '30, c.f.; A. L. Devens '30, r.f.

The Freshman nines, outside for the first time, played an informal six inning game, in which team B defeated team A by a 6 to 2 score. The line-ups follow:

Team A--B. H. Ticknor '31, E. C. Samborski '31, p.; S. L. Batchelder '31, D. M. Puffer '31, c.; F. L. Winston '31, 1b.; S. L. Putman '31, 2b.; R. S. Ogden '31, 3b.; E. H. McGrath '31, s.s.; G. A. Donaldson '31, l.f.; B. H. Bassett '31, c.f.; R. S. Leonard '31, r.f.

Team B--Robert Gilmor '31, P. M. Sidel '31, p.; E. L. Sims '31, c.; Pliny Jewell '31, 1b.; E. J. Des Roches '31, 2b.; Harwood Ellis '31, 3b.; A. D. Weeks '31, s.s.; J. H. Parker '31, l.f.; Marshall Stearus '31, c.f.; M. F. Whorf '31, r.f.
